Which is better in VLSI-NAND or NOR implementation? why?

Answer Posted / hemant tulsani

NAND is better because
1. The 2 pmos transistors in series in case of NOR
implementation will make it slow becuse of low mobility of
holes which are majority carriers in case of pmos.
2. So to match the speed of the operation of Pmos to nmos,
the size of the pmos has to be increased. I results in
higher chip area consumption and hence higher cost.
